git@vger.kernel.org mailing list mirror (one of many)
 help / color / mirror / code / Atom feed
* suggestion for git glossary: upstream, downstream
@ 2020-12-29 13:15 Steve Summit
  2021-01-04 23:57 ` Junio C Hamano
  0 siblings, 1 reply; 2+ messages in thread
From: Steve Summit @ 2020-12-29 13:15 UTC (permalink / raw)
  To: git; +Cc: scs

The terms "upstream" and "downstream" are heavily used in much
writing about git, with obvious meanings and implications for
those who use git regularly, but they're not defined at
https://git-scm.com/docs/gitglossary .  Perhaps they should be?
(Sorry, I'm not nearly experienced enough with git yet to write
good definitions myself, though.)

^ permalink raw reply	[flat|nested] 2+ messages in thread

* Re: suggestion for git glossary: upstream, downstream
  2020-12-29 13:15 suggestion for git glossary: upstream, downstream Steve Summit
@ 2021-01-04 23:57 ` Junio C Hamano
  0 siblings, 0 replies; 2+ messages in thread
From: Junio C Hamano @ 2021-01-04 23:57 UTC (permalink / raw)
  To: Steve Summit; +Cc: git

scs@eskimo.com (Steve Summit) writes:

> The terms "upstream" and "downstream" are heavily used in much
> writing about git, with obvious meanings and implications for
> those who use git regularly, but they're not defined at
> https://git-scm.com/docs/gitglossary .  Perhaps they should be?
> (Sorry, I'm not nearly experienced enough with git yet to write
> good definitions myself, though.)

Yup, 'upstream' has clear definition and we use the phrase a lot.
'downstream', not that much, primarily because your repository may
have its upstream (singular) but typically you may not even know the
set of people who consider your repository their upstream.

Having said that, there isn't much we can actually say about
'upstream' as a unversal truth, no?  I can readily think of this:

    Your upstream is the line(s) of history you base your
    development on.

but beyond that, there aren't much that is common across different
workflows how 'upstream' appears to you.  Sometimes you may ask your
changes to be pulled by it, sometimes you may directly push into it
while others like you who consider it their upstream do the same.

So...

^ permalink raw reply	[flat|nested] 2+ messages in thread

end of thread, other threads:[~2021-01-04 23:58 UTC | newest]

Thread overview: 2+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2020-12-29 13:15 suggestion for git glossary: upstream, downstream Steve Summit
2021-01-04 23:57 ` Junio C Hamano

Code repositories for project(s) associated with this public inbox

	https://80x24.org/mirrors/git.git

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).